At age 21 you can
Adoption
You can adopt a child.
Legal
If you were ‘looked after’ by the local authority between ages of 16 and 18, the local authority continues to be under a duty to advise and ‘befriend’ you, and in exceptional circumstances, to assist you financially up to the age of 24.
Political participation
You can become a Member of Parliament, a local councillor or a local mayor.
